Wahiawa-based Da Burger Wing Hub is known for its epic, loaded burgers and juicy chicken wings, but having a bar space has always been a part of the plan.
“We have a chill bar and handcrafted drinks with fresh flavors to go with our menu,” says business owner Arjay Mijares. “That was always the plan, since I’ve opened it (the restaurant). We want to bring the Waikīkī vibe to Wahiawa, but make sure our clientele feels at home.”

The burger shop’s new cocktail menu includes a variety of tequila-, gin-, vodka- and whiskey-based cocktails. Options include the DBWH (Da Burger Wing Hub) margarita ($15), lychee martini ($12) and liliko‘i mule ($12). If you want something with a social media-worthy presentation, go for the smoked Old Fashioned ($15), which features Elijah Craig Bourbon and chocolate bitters.
“We’ll have featured cocktails every month,” Mijares says. “In May, we’ll have Cinco de Mayo-themed and Mexican drinks.”


Da Burger Wing Hub also features monthly food specials. Customers can enjoy loaded pulled pork nachos ($18) and a Cajun taco salad ($18). The latter includes a larger-than-life, deep-fried tortilla shell filled with salad topped with pico de gallo, fresh avocado, Cajun shrimp, jalapenos and ancho ranch dressing.

Stay tuned — May food specials will include fun dishes like birria burgers and chimichanga burritos, according to Mijares.
